titleOfInvention | Triglyceride determination kit and determination method thereof |
abstract | The invention provides a triglyceride determination kit, which comprises a liquid single reagent R1, wherein the reagent R1 comprises the following components and concentrations thereof: lipoprotein esterase, glycerol kinase, glycerol phosphate oxidase, peroxidase, piperazine-1, 4-diethylsulfonic acid, NaOH, 4-aminoantipyrine, adenosine triphosphate, N-ethyl-N- (2-hydroxy-3-sulfopropyl) -3-methylaniline sodium salt or N-ethyl-N- (2-hydroxy-3-sulfopropyl) -3' 5-dimethoxyaniline sodium salt, sodium glutamate, magnesium acetate, flavin adenine dinucleotide, polyethylene glycol, betaine solution. The invention belongs to the technical field of biological detection, and provides a triglyceride determination kit which can improve the stability of a reagent and simultaneously remarkably enhance the anti-interference capability, and has good determination accuracy when used for triglyceride determination. |
